Hundreds of Indian, B'deshi workers accuse Singapore firms of unpaid wages

Around 400 migrant workers from India and Bangladesh have accused two companies registered in Singapore of not paying them wages. The country's manpower ministry has launched an investigation into the allegations by the first 100 workers. As complaints have gone up, caterers reportedly stopped supplying food to the workers a few days ago, saying they were not getting paid.
